Holyfield fought last night. I guess he did. Disgraceful. Absolutely disgraceful. What Evander Holyfield did in the ring Saturday night didn't conjure up memories of 45-year-old George Foreman's electrifying knockout of Michael Moorer in 1994. Holyfield wasn't impressive. He did not rattle Nikolai Valuev's enlarged cranium nor did he dazzle the capacity crowd in Zurich, Switzerland, with impressive flurries. Instead, Holyfield was a human carousel, dancing around the 7-foot Valuev (who ably played the part of the post) and occasionally pausing to throw a meek punch or two. But he absolutely, positively won the fight. That three professional judges could score the fight for Valuev, and thereby deny Holyfield his fifth reign as heavyweight champion, is embarrassing. Valuev was awful. He didn't land one effective punch, much less a combination. He dispassionately allowed Holyfield to dictate the tempo of the fight while showing a complete and utter inability to use his long jab to keep the challenger at bay. He was sluggish and at times looked fearful of an opponent that had no possibility of hurting him. God the state of boxing is pathetic. Does anyone own all three belts now?
